•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:AjaxとMVCについて)

AjaxとMVCについて

このQ&Aのポイント
  • テキストフィールドに入力して、送信ボタンを押したら、データベースを呼び出し、結果を表示するAjaxについて、MVCを意識して連携する方法を教えてください。
  • 現在はJSPとJavaScriptで連携し、データベースの接続や結果セットの取得を行っていますが、サーブレットやJavaBeansを活用することでMVCの原則に則ったコードを書きたいです。
  • DWRなどのライブラリも検討していますが、まずは基本的な方法についてアドバイスをいただきたいです。

質問者が選んだベストアンサー

  • ベストアンサー
  • auty
  • ベストアンサー率58% (284/486)
回答No.1

>>> httpObject.open("GET","kakunin.jsp?nen="+encnen,true);  の部分なんですが、ここのkakunin.jspをサーブレットにしたら、responseTextをサーブレットで作らなくてはならないような事になりそうな気がしてやめました。 MVCを採用するなら、ここはサーブレットでよいのでは? そのサーブレットはコントローラとして、必要に応じて >>> サーブレットやJavaBeansを呼び出して、複雑な処理を を行い、それらの情報を新しい「kakunin.jsp」へ送り、テーブル形式のデータに加工して、text/plainとして送り返すということになると思います。

ossu
質問者

お礼

アドバイスありがとうございます。その方法でやってみます。

すると、全ての回答が全文表示されます。

関連するQ&A